IN RE CONDEMNATION PROCEEDING FOR WILMARTH

No. CO-85-874.

380 N.W.2d 127 (1986)

In re CONDEMNATION PROCEEDING FOR the WILMARTH LINE OF the CU PROJECT.

Court of Appeals of Minnesota.

January 14, 1986.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John E. Drawz, Minneapolis, for appellant Coop. Power Ass'n.

Roger C. Miller, South St. Paul, for appellant United Power Ass'n.

Kenneth E. Tilsen, St. Paul, for respondents.

Heard, considered and decided by HUSPENI, P.J., FOLEY and FORSBERG, JJ.


OPINION

FOLEY, Judge.

Appellants, Cooperative Power Association and United Power Association, appeal from that part of a judgment granting respondents attorney's fees and costs of $340,450.84, following appellants' dismissal of condemnation proceedings.
